November/December 2018 LDCHA RESIDENT SERVICES My name is Danae Nelson, and I am excited to serve as the new Americorps Member at Resident Services. I will be assisting housing applicants with looking for community resources and completing applications and Section 8 voucher holders looking for units. My background is in child welfare, specifically working with young adults who have aged out of the foster care system. I graduated from Washburn with a Bachelor of Social Work and am working on a Master of Social Work degree at KU. I’m a HUGE college basketball fan, which makes being in Lawrence all that much better. Gift cards are available for these meetings as well (1 per person). Christina Gentry, Community Liaison with the Lawrence-Douglas County Health Department, wants to talk to you! She is seeking input from working or work-able adults on employment barriers. What makes getting and keeping a job difficult? What would make it easier? She wants your input! Christina is focusing on Edgewood and Eastside neighborhood residents for her project over the next two years. Christina will host “Occupation Conversation” focus groups at the Huppee every Wednesday in November from 6-7 pm. Call to RSVP, 785-842-1533. Participants will receive dinner, childcare, and a gift card for attending (1 per person). Come add your voice to the conversation!
